Induction Motors Applications, Control and Fault Diagnostics

This book is organized into four sections, covering the applications and structural properties of induction motors, fault detection and diagnostics, control strategies, and the more recently developed topology based on the multiphase induction motors. This material should be of specific interest to engineers and researchers who are engaged in the modeling, design, and implementation of control algorithms applied to induction motors and, more generally, to readers broadly interested in nonlinear control, health condition monitoring, and fault diagnosis.

Controlling 3 Phase AC Induction Motors Using the PIC18F4431 (PDF)

This application note describes how the PIC18F4431 may be used to control an ACIM using open and closed-loop V/f control strategies.

DC Motor Control Tips n Tricks (PDF 36p)

This note explains many basic circuits and software building blocks commonly used to control motors. Topics covered include: Brushed DC Motor Drive Circuits, Brushless DC Motor Drive Circuits, Stepper Motor Drive Circuits, Drive Software, Writing a PWM Value to the CCP Registers with a Mid-range PICmicroŽ MCU.17, Current Sensing and Position/Speed Sensing.
